CIFFNV PITCHFEST! - Pitch your project to an incredible Line-up of Cordillera Grand & Special Jury Members for a chance to win an impressive Prize Package courtesy of our Industry Partners, and the Film Nevada Initiative as well as select members of our 2024 Grand Jury and Special Jury.

Finalists: 10 Projects will be selected to Pitch in-person, on the morning of Sunday, September 29th 2024 during our annual film festival.

Lottery Drawing: Everyone who submits for CIFFNV PITCHFEST! and attends the festival in-person, will be entered into a Lottery Drawing where 5 lucky projects will get selected to Pitch!

Time: This is a 3 minute pitch, followed by 3 minutes of questions/feedback from panelists.

TO SUBMIT:
Email info@ciffNV.org with the following information:
1. Your Name.
2. Your FilmFreeway Tracking Number - individuals may submit more than one pitch, but each submission must have it's own tracking number. Note: No individual will be allowed to pitch more than one project during the actual event. CIFF will select which of your submitted projects will be pitched.

Upon verifying your entry, you will be emailed a custom link to upload your materials.
The link will ask you to provide: Project Name, Project Type (Narrative or Documentary. Feature Film or Short. Web or Television Series.) Project Logline & Synopsis. Optional Materials: Pitch Deck and/or One Sheet. Please do NOT send scripts or treatments.

-Cordillera International Film Festival only accepts live-action films and music videos that have been completed after July 2022 and animated films that have been completed by January 2020.
- Our Main Venue is DCP Only. We use Simple DCP. You can use their service to make a DCP for 20% off, or you can upload your own DCP to their service at no cost.
- Online screeners from secure sources are preferred. Include screener link and password in your submission.
- Press kit is optional - electronic only, please.
- Nevada, World and US Premieres are not required, however premiere status may be one of the factors considered when determining a film's inclusion in the Festival.
-The Festival does not screen Feature films available on VOD or any online streaming portal at the time of the festival. However, the festival reserves the right to make exceptions to this rule. Non-Local Short Films & Music Videos can be available online, but films that are not online will be given preference.
-All films in a language other than English must be subtitled in English for festival presentation.
-The festival will consider work-in-progress, films with temporary soundtracks, digital outputs, and work that did not originate on film. Filmmakers must deliver final format (as indicated) for Festival screening.
-Future Filmmaker films MUST be works written, directed, and shot by students actively enrolled in school and must be 25 YEARS OLD OR YOUNGER.
